Exercise Physiology Pre Reviewed Journals
Exercise Physiology has evolved from this study of anatomy and physiology and examines how our body's structures and functions are altered when we are exposed to acute and chronic bouts of exercise. It is primarily the study of how the body adapts physiologically to the acute short term exercise and the chronic. Sports Physiology further applies these concepts from exercise physiology specifically to training the athlete and improve athlete performance within a specific sport. Exercise and sport physiology is about improving performance, by knowing how the body functions during exercise and using technological principles to allow your body to train better, perform better, and recover quicker. Studies in exercise physiology help athletes achieve greatness e.g. it is now known that Olympic weightlifting and plyometric training are two methods to increase vertical jump height
